The Great White North Immigration & Living: Key Details
Navigating existence in Canada involves understanding a few crucial aspects, particularly regarding emigration. Canada consistently welcomes a significant number of newcomers each year, striving to maintain a population increase and address employee shortages. The country's immigration system is point-based, prioritizing skilled workers, but also offering pathways for kin reunification, refugees, and provincial nominee programs. Becoming copyright typically involves a rigorous application process, including language proficiency tests (in the common tongue) and medical examinations. Beyond the application, Canada boasts a high quality of well-being, with universal healthcare, a strong social safety system, and diverse cultural landscapes – though it’s important to note the price of living, especially in major cities like Toronto and Vancouver, can be high. Prospective individuals should also research specific provincial requirements and possible job opportunities to ensure a smooth relocation.
Understanding the Student Direct Stream (SDS) Canada: Criteria & Procedure
The Student Direct Stream (SDS) is a streamlined immigration option for eligible international students applying to study in Canada. In order to be considered, applicants generally must be accepted at a Designated Learning Institution (DLI), possess proof of sufficient financial resources to cover tuition, living expenses, and return transportation, and demonstrate a clear intention to complete their program and depart Canada upon graduation. Specifically, the SDS requires a digital photograph meeting specific guidelines, a letter of acceptance from the DLI, and police certificates from any country where the applicant has lived for six consecutive months or longer. The submission is primarily online, allowing for faster processing times – often within a few months – compared to the regular study permit application. However pre-approval, final decisions remain at the discretion of the immigration officer, and all essential documentation must be accurate and complete to avoid delays or refusal. Keep in mind that eligibility and guidelines are subject to change, so always consult the official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) website for the most up-to-date information.
